Hi,
I do not want the title image of my view to appear on the view tab, but I could not find a way to hide it yet.
I tried to invoke the setTitleImage(null) in the init() and in the createPartControl() methods, but no luck.
Please let me know if you have any suggestion.

Prakash G.R. wrote on Mon, 12 October 2009 23:04 | Marton Sigmond wrote:
> I do not want the title image of my view to appear on the view tab, but
> I could not find a way to hide it yet.
What if you don't specify the image in the plugin.xml?
- Prakash
Platform UI Team, IBM
http://blog.eclipse-tips.com
|
That doesn't function, because in this case, the eclipse standard icon will be shown.
I dont know if there is a chance, but as a workaround you can create a 16 x 16 icon with an transparent background, and use this as the view icon. So you dont see an icon, there is only a small free place previous the viewtitle
